If you have lost or damaged your original registration certificate (RC) for your bike, you might be wondering how to get a duplicate one. In this article, we will explain how to get a duplicate RC for a bike in India, what are the documents required, what the fees involved, and how long it takes.
Documents required for duplicate RC for bike
To apply for a duplicate RC for the bike, you will need the following documents:
- Application form 26 (available online or at the regional transport office)
- FIR copy (if the RC is lost or stolen)
- Challan clearance report from traffic police (if applicable)
- PUC certificate (pollution under control)
- Insurance certificate
- Tax receipt
- Identity proof and address proof of the owner
- Affidavit stating the reason for applying for duplicate RC
- Original RC (if damaged)
Fees for duplicate RC for bike
The fees for duplicate RC for bikes vary depending on the state and the type of vehicle. However, the approximate fees are as follows:
- Application fee: Rs. 200
- Smart card fee: Rs. 200
- Postal charges: Rs. 50
The total fee is around Rs. 450, which can be paid online or offline.
How to apply for duplicate RC for bike
There are two ways to apply for duplicate RC for bike: online and offline.
Online method:
- Visit the official website of your state’s transport department and select the option for duplicate RC.
Visit – https://parivahan.gov.in/parivahan//en/content/duplicate-rc - Fill in the application form 26 with the required details and upload the scanned copies of the documents.
- Pay the fees online using a debit card, credit card, or net banking.
- Submit the application and take a printout of the acknowledgment slip.
- You will receive an SMS with the application status and tracking number.
- You can track your application online using the tracking number.
- Once your application is approved, you will receive your duplicate RC by post at your registered address.
Offline method:
- Visit the nearest regional transport office (RTO) and collect the application form 26.
- Fill in the form with the required details and attach the photocopies of the documents.
- Pay the fees at the cash counter and get a receipt.
- Submit the application and the receipt at the RTO counter.
- You will receive an acknowledgment slip with the application number.
- You can check your application status at the RTO or by calling their helpline number.
- Once your application is approved, you can collect your duplicate RC from the RTO.
How long does it take to get a duplicate RC for a bike
The time taken to get duplicate RC for a bike depends on various factors such as the state, the RTO, and the verification process. However, generally, it takes about 15 to 30 days to get your duplicate RC by post or by hand.
